BackgroundInterleukin 9, also known as IL9, is a TH2 cytokine1 belonging to the group of interleukins. This cytokine stimulates cell proliferation and prevents apoptosis. It functions through the interleukin-9 receptor (IL9R), which activates different signal transducer and activator (STAT) proteins and thus connects this cytokine to various biological processes. IL-9 stimulates the proliferation of a variety of hematopoietic lineages through its interaction with a receptor of the cytokine receptor superfamily.2 IL-9 plays a role in the complex pathogenesis of bronchial hyperresponsiveness as a risk factor for asthma.3 Protein DetailsPurity >97% by SDS-PAGE and analyzed by silver stain. Endotoxin Level <0.1 EU/µg as determined by the LAL method Biological Activity Measured in a cell proliferation assay using TS1 mouse helper T cells.<sup>4</sup> The ED<sub>50</sub> for this effect is 0.01‑0.03 ng/mL. Protein Accession No. Amino Acid Sequence qrcsttwgir dtnylienlk ddppskcscs gnvtsclcls vptddcttpc yregllqltn atqksrllpv fhrvkrivev lknitcpsfs cekpcnqtma gntlsflksl lgtfqktemq rqksrp N-terminal Sequence Analysis Gln19 is predicted State of Matter Lyophilized Predicted Molecular Mass The predicted molecular weight of Recombinant Mouse IL-9 is Mr 14.2 kDa. However, multiple bands were observed by migration on SDS-PAGE with an actual molecular weight between 16-25 kDa (reducing conditions). Predicted Molecular Mass 14.2 Formulation This recombinant protein was 0.2 µm filtered and lyophilized from modified Dulbecco’s phosphate buffered saline (1X PBS) pH 7.2 – 7.3 with no calcium, magnesium, or preservatives. Storage and Stability This lyophilized protein is stable for six to twelve months when stored desiccated at -20°C to -70°C. After aseptic reconstitution, this protein may be stored at 2°C to 8°C for one month or at -20°C to -70°C in a manual defrost freezer. Avoid Repeated Freeze Thaw Cycles.
